Sprinkles of Palm Beach
Sprinkles of Palm Beach has been inspected four times since 2022. The latest inspection on file is from Dec 2, 2024. Low risk means the most recent visit produced few or no significant findings.
Inspection results have stayed in a similar range over the last few visits, averaging around two violations each.
The pattern that stands out is “manager or person in charge lacking proof”, which has been cited two times.
The city-wide average for Palm Beach sits at 84, putting Sprinkles of Palm Beach on the better side of that line. There isn't much in the file that would give a customer pause.
